WSP has a new opportunity for a Contaminated Sites Project Manager to join our Remediation Program Management team based in Edmonton, Saskatoon, Winnipeg and Calgary. This new opportunity will require you to manage risk and closure of contaminated sites. You will design and oversee field work related to monitoring, investigating, and remediating contaminated sites impacted by hydrocarbons (diesel, gasoline crude oil etc.) fertilizers and metals, as well as prepare technical reports. Key Responsibilities: Create a safe and positive environment for colleagues. Lead a project team and take on responsibilities including: Preparing health and safety plans and emergency response plans. Preparation of proposals and cost estimates. Scheduling of field staff and subcontractors. Report writing including preparing conclusions and recommendations Project accounting, tracking and reporting requirements to the terms of reference under WSP’s Master Services Agreements. Training junior staff in environmental practices including Phase I and II ESAs, drilling, surveying, groundwater sampling, oversight of remediation etc. Training staff on site specific health and safety. Manage client relationships. Collaborate across the national RPM team and WSP. Provide guidance and mentorship to environmental scientists. Develop a personal career development plan with specific goals to achieve your career aspirations. Requirements: Bachelor’s degree in related field (sciences and/or Engineering). Minimum 8 years of experience in contaminated site assessments. Sound understanding of the need for health and safety procedures in the workplace/Possess a safety conscious attitude. An analytical mind; someone who is able to make recommendations on the next steps for client sites. Strong business acumen and financial management experience, developing, tracking and forecasting on annual budgets. Previous experience with soil and ground water sampling and remediation. Understanding of the Alberta, Saskatchewan and Manitoba Environmental regulations Professional designation is preferred Experience in the oil and gas sector will be an asset About Us: WSP is one of the world's leading professional services firms.
